It’s no secret that people of different religions often clash over their differences. But when you look closer, the similarities jump out, especially when it comes to significant objects. 

On Wednesday's Up to Date, our Religion Roundtable takes a look at why objects such as stones, crosses, bread, drums and incense have places of prominence in spiritual observance and how their function differs in each religion.

Guests:

  • MahnazShabbir, president of Shabbir Advisors
  • Moses Brings Plenty, community outreach liaison at the Kansas City Indian Center
  • YangsiRinpoche, president of Maitripa College in Portland, Ore.
